HANDLING YOUR DATA

Six Practical Privacy Controls At baru55

We handle Privacy Policy requests through the same account and payment records used to keep account access accurate.

Account matching

When you open an account, we connect the phone verification result with your account record. This reduces mistaken matches when several payment references appear, and it gives us a practical way to confirm that a privacy request comes from the account holder.

Device signals

A mobile browser may send basic device and session signals when you sign in or move from login to the lobby. We use these signals to detect unusual access patterns, not to publish a personal profile or read unrelated content on your device.

Cookie choices

Cookies can keep a session connected while you move between account pages and a payment status screen. Your browser controls whether suitable cookies remain active. Turning some off may affect sign-in continuity, but it does not erase account records by itself.

Payment matching

A DANA, OVO, GoPay or QRIS reference helps us match a receipt with the correct account. Bank transfer and virtual account records may include a reference, amount and status needed to resolve a payment question without storing your wallet password.

Retention periods

We keep account, support and payment records for the time needed to operate the requested service, resolve disputes, protect account access or meet a legal duty. When a purpose ends, we remove, restrict or anonymise the related data where suitable.

Change requests

You can ask us to correct a wrong phone detail, clarify a stored payment reference or explain how a record was used. Send the request through account support; we may verify ownership first, then respond according to local law and the record involved.
